An orientation for new residents of Lakewood Ranch is set for 4-6 p.m. Oct. 12 at Lakewood Ranch Town Hall.
The informational program is designed to educate residents regarding the roles and responsibilities of Lakewood Ranch Town Hall to include the Inter-District Authority, the community development districts, and the homeowners’ associations. Residents will learn about their local governmental structure and how each of these agencies work together.
Attendance is open to any Lakewood Ranch resident interested in the program but seating is limited. RSVP by 5 p.m. Oct. 5 to Kay DePaolo at (941) 907-0202 or via e-mail at kay.depaolo@lwrtownhall.com.
